Alexander the Great, also known as Aleksandr the Great, was a legendary leader who left an indelible mark on history. His story is one of triumph, conquest, and ambition. From his humble beginnings as the son of King Philip II of Macedon to his untimely death at the age of 32, Alexander’s life was a rollercoaster of victories and defeats.
Born in 356 BC, Alexander was destined for greatness. He received a rigorous education under the tutelage of the renowned philosopher Aristotle, who instilled in him a love for learning and a thirst for knowledge. This early education would shape Alexander’s character and set him on a path of intellectual curiosity and military prowess.
At the age of 20, Alexander ascended to the throne after his father’s assassination. He wasted no time in asserting his authority and embarked on a mission to expand his empire. With an army of loyal soldiers, he conquered vast territories, including Egypt, Persia, and India. His military strategies were innovative and his leadership skills unparalleled. He was a master tactician, always one step ahead of his enemies.
But Alexander’s ambition knew no bounds. As he continued his conquests, he became increasingly ruthless and power-hungry. He would stop at nothing to achieve his goals, even if it meant sacrificing the lives of his own men. This ruthless pursuit of power ultimately led to his downfall.
Despite his flaws, Alexander’s legacy is undeniable. He was a visionary leader who brought together diverse cultures and fostered a sense of unity among his subjects. He encouraged the exchange of ideas and promoted cultural assimilation. His empire became a melting pot of different traditions and beliefs, leaving a lasting impact on the regions he conquered.
Alexander’s influence extended beyond his military conquests. He was a patron of the arts and sciences, supporting scholars and artists in their endeavors. He founded the city of Alexandria, which became a center of learning and intellectual discourse. His patronage of the arts helped to preserve and promote the cultural heritage of the lands he conquered.
